Dealing with random luck in life

Everything happens for a reason. In a world as big, complex, and interconnected as ours, that reason is frequently random luck. It’s not good or bad, for you or against you, personal or preferential. It just happens.

Factors beyond our grasp shape our lives. Forces outside our control alter our path. Luck and randomness are real. As real as our responsibility to deal with what they deliver to us.

Sometimes bad news meets bad timing. The winds of fortune carry you down a dark passage. Sometimes good news meets good timing. The winds of fortune propel you in a favorable direction.

Winds of fortune don’t play favorites and no wind blows forever. Winds change. They always change.

Embrace the chase. Do the work.
